![]() ![]() ![]() Here, the foreach loop is used for iterating over the array of elements in $myarray. PHP features an if structure that is similar to that of C: if (expr) statement As described in the section about expressions, expression is evaluated to its Boolean value. run foreach loop to every element of array. Solution 4: Using Foreach Loop to Print Element of an Array // Declare a PHP array So, the method takes the array and converts its elements into a string and joins them using a ‘,’ separator. Here, the method is passed ‘,’ as the separator and $myarray as the array argument. This method returns a string after accepting an array of elements as input. one that is true at both the beginning and ending of every loop. In this code, the implode() method is used. A for loop stop condition should test the loop counter against an invariant value (i.e. Convert array to string by using implode function. Solution 3: Using PHP Inbuilt Function implode() to Convert Array to String // Declare a PHP array Then it prints the elements in the form of key and value pairs as shown below. It first displays the type of the variable, which is an array in this case. Here, the var_dump method takes the parameter $myarray and prints out the type and the structured information about that variable. Solution 2: Using Built-in PHP Function var_dump // Declare a PHP array ![]() The keys here are the indexes and the values are the elements in those index positions. Here, the print_r method takes the parameter $myarray and prints its values in the form of keys and values. Print PHP array using print_r() functions. Note the placement of parentheses, spaces, and braces and that else and elseif are on the same line as the closing. Solution 1: Using Builtin PHP Function print_r // Declare a PHP array An if structure looks like the following. Using Foreach Loop to Print Element of an Array.Using PHP Inbuilt Function implode() to Convert Array to String.The five ways to solve this error are as follows: When you type $myarray or $myarray, echo and print will be able to recognize it as an array and then display the values.įor example, $myarray = array(1,2,3,4,5,6,7,7) The easiest solution to this problem is to mention the index values along with the echo and print statement. As the echo and print statement is used for printing strings values and scalar values, so when they are not able to treat an array variable as a string. The error is encountered here as the code tries to print the array called myarray like a string. Notice: Array to string conversion in \phpprint.php on line 9 ![]() Output Notice: Array to string conversion in \phpprint.php on line 8 Print PHP array using echo and print() functions. This error comes when we try to print array variable as a string using the built-in PHP function print() or echo. When you add the dependencies for the first time, the first run might be a little slow as we download the dependencies, but the subsequent runs will be faster.In this article, we will take a look at the Array to string conversion error in PHP and try to solve it. Users can add dependencies in the adle file and use them in their programs. OneCompiler supports Gradle for dependency management. Following is a sample program that shows reading STDIN ( A string in this case ). Using Scanner class in Java program, you can read the inputs. OneCompiler's Java online editor supports stdin and users can give inputs to the programs using the STDIN textbox under the I/O tab. The editor shows sample boilerplate code when you choose language as Java and start coding. Getting started with the OneCompiler's Java editor is easy and fast. It's one of the robust, feature-rich online compilers for Java language, running the Java LTS version 17. Write, Run & Share Java code online using OneCompiler's Java online compiler for free.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|